About this Costume
- Construction Details:
- I took a lot of liberties with this costume, mainly because the design was SO flat and cartoony. I patterned the vest/top myself and made it out of a textured hot pink twill. Underneath is a spaghetti strap pink dress, with a GIANT hoopskirt. I made the dress by altering a bridal pattern. I chose a light pink casa satin for the dress, to contrast with the textured hot pink vest. The hoopskirt was purchased on ebay. Instead of making gloves, I just made covers for a pink pair that I had already. The front panel was made by cutting out the shapes and fusing them to the fabric with heat and bond. The whole panel is interfaced so it would be sturdy. The jewelry elements of this costume (tiara, crown) were made by casting elements out of hot glue and painting them with gold acrylic paint.

- Styling Notes
- This wig was really hard! It was my first ponytail wig, and I quickly learned that what looks right on the wig head does not necessarily look right on your head. Basically, I kept making it too tight/small. I had to use over 9,000 wig pins to keep this thing on, and it ended up being pretty uncomfortable. Plus, you can hardly even see the ponytail in photos.
